What Does It Mean to Dream About Being a Soldier Engaging Enemy Forces?

Dreaming about being a soldier in a combat scenario can evoke a variety of emotions and reflections. In your dream, you found yourself on a rooftop, engaging enemy forces as they attempted to infiltrate a building. This imagery is powerful and suggests themes of conflict, protection, and perhaps even empowerment. The act of eliminating the enemy leader could symbolize a significant victory in your waking life, whether it relates to personal challenges or external conflicts.

Such dreams often arise during times of stress or when facing difficult situations that require courage and strategic thinking. They can reflect a desire to assert control over chaotic circumstances or to confront issues that feel threatening. Key Symbols and Their Meanings

  • Soldier: Represents discipline, duty, and the readiness to confront challenges. It may indicate that you are prepared to face personal battles.
  • Enemy Forces: Symbolizes obstacles or conflicts in your life, possibly reflecting external pressures or internal struggles.
  • Rooftop: Suggests a vantage point or a higher perspective, indicating clarity in understanding your situation.
  • Ladder: Represents progress or ascension, suggesting that you are working your way up through challenges.
  • Eliminating a Leader: This act can signify overcoming significant barriers or taking decisive action against a major issue in your life.

Interpretation Based on Historical and Psychological Sources

  • Modern Dream Meaning: Recent interpretations suggest that combat dreams often reflect your need to assert yourself and confront challenges head-on. They may also indicate feelings of empowerment or a desire to take control over your life circumstances.
  • Ancient, Cultural, and Religious Views: Many cultures view soldiers in dreams as protectors or warriors faced with trials. In Native American traditions, for example, warriors symbolize bravery and the fight for what is right.
  • Freudian and Jungian Perspectives: Freud might interpret this dream as a manifestation of repressed aggression or unresolved conflicts. In contrast, Jung could suggest that engaging in battle signifies a necessary confrontation with the shadow self, leading to personal growth and individuation.
